Output 523ecfeef267932d415518894079f4f59ab5a77f7c1ce76d621708e4f3bb5f32:3

value
2096005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97e18b4c36691c1131b2081a6635e8d9a27ed6cd OP_EQUAL
address
3FY69bEsdKZZH9mxu6MwjwafXnPib7ecjz
transaction
523ecfeef267932d415518894079f4f59ab5a77f7c1ce76d621708e4f3bb5f32